Yanawana Herbolarios is a 501(c)3 organization (EIN 460969842) operating primarily in the San Antonio metro community, with a mission to share, preserve, and honor cultural knowledge of the land and make it universally accessible as a means to empower and revive the practice of holistic living, medical botanical usage, water and land stewardship, and coming together as a community in times of need. Yanawana Herbolarios is a woman-led and Indigenous-founded organization. Yanawana Herbolarios was established in January 2016 to meet unaddressed needs in the areas of healthcare and preparedness in the under-served communities of Bexar (and surrounding) Counties, with a special focus on BIPOC and LGBTQ communities. Our current programming includes: The People’s Clinic – accessible integrative healthcare clinics, Sowing la Futura – plant and ancestral skills education, Yanawana Medic Collective – a street medicine team supporting people’s movements and the houseless, and Project Home – sustainable transition campgrounds for the houseless community.

 

Grant Administrator

The Grant Administration Intern will coordinate and oversee the grant application and management process including the identification of potential new funding sources, development of funding resources for existing and proposed programs, writing grants, developing budgets, collaborating on grant applications with various directors and partner organizations, and processing, monitoring and coordinating required report evaluations on existing grants.

 

Some example responsibilities include:

·         Monitors the financial management of grants for the purpose of complying with all program and funding guidelines of awarding organizations

·         Compiles necessary data, then works in collaboration with directors to write grants

·         Assists program directors in monitoring measurable outcomes as required by funding sources

·         Completes necessary data entry to maintain metrics and compile regular grant reports

·         Seeks additional funding sources to support, expand, and develop new programming in alignment with the vision of the leadership team

·         Manages program files and records, maintains databases of measurables outcomes

·         Develops and manages systems for tracking grant expenditures and receivables

·         Reviews all grant related payment requests, bills, invoices, and statements, to be presented to and approved by director

·         Cultivates and sustains relationships with funders throughout the community to promote the Yanawana Herbolarios mission and our work to develop lasting partnerships
